    Abstract

    According to edge-wave diffraction theory, we have analyzed and compared the edge-wave diffraction intensity of gaussian(n=2)、parabolic(n=1,2) functions and linear taper variable reflectivity mirrors. Numerical results show that gaussian and super-gaussian reflectivity mirrors can reduce the edge-wave diffraction intensity more effectively, and obtain zeroth-order approximate geometrical optical fields.
